NEHLS v. QUAD-K. ADVERTISING, INC.

No. 67358.

106 Ohio App.3d 489 (1995)

NEHLS, Appellee, v. QUAD-K. ADVERTISING, INC.,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Ohio, Eighth District, Cuyahoga County.

Decided July 3, 1995.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Betty D. Montgomery, Attorney General, and Marilyn Tobocman, Assistant Attorney General, for appellee.

William M. Crosby, for appellant.


NUGENT, Judge.

This is an appeal brought pursuant to R.C. 4112.061 from a decision of the Cuyahoga County Common Pleas Court which affirmed the order of the Ohio Civil Rights Commission. The commission, by its order, found in favor of appellee, Arleen M. Nehls, on claims of sexual harassment and constructive discharge against Abe Giterman, owner and president of appellant, Quad-K. Advertising, Inc.
